Worth A Chat Profile

Worth A Chat is a 6 year old bay gelding. Worth A Chat is trained by M K Mason, at Tamworth and owned by H J Justin, B Justin, S A Shann, S A Barker, P N McKenzie, N J Quinn, S Miles, M W Highett, S Raines & S I Singleton.

Worth A Chat’s last race event was at 13/12/2022 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Worth A Chat Racing Form

Career form is wins, seconds, thirds from 5 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$2,445.

With a 0% Win Percentage and 0% Place Percentage. Worth A Chat's last race event was at Tamworth.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-8-7-5-7.
